Budget to Certify

October 31, 2018 7:30 am

CUNA’s Credit Union Board Certification School (formerly known as CUNA Volunteer Certification School) is now open for 2019 registration. The school continues to provide board members with valuable education and networking opportunities. It is scheduled May 6-10 in San Antonio, TX.

“This class was perfect size. It enabled volunteers to interact and bond with each other while learning and exchanging ideas with speakers during and after sessions. The material presented had substance that I can take back and share with our board rooms.” said former attendee Amy White, board member at Kerr County FCU in Texas.

“We’ve designed this school to provide a comprehensive understanding of the fundamentals of board responsibilities,” said Maegan Monson, instructional design manager at CUNA. “While it’s especially useful for board members with less knowledge on credit union operations and board governance, attendees of all experience levels can gain critical insights from our expert speakers.”

Attendees will also have the opportunity to earn the Certified Credit Union Board Member designation with onsite exams, provided other prerequisites have been met. Make plans now to include this great opportunity in your 2019 board training budget.
